#3dcb52 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3dcb52 is composed of 23.9% red, 79.6% green and 32.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 70% cyan, 0% magenta, 59.6% yellow and 20.4% black. It has a hue angle of 128.9 degrees, a saturation of 57.7% and a lightness of 51.8%. #3dcb52 color hex could be obtained by blending #7affa4 with #009700. Closest websafe color is: #33cc66.

#3dcb52 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#3dcb52 has RGB values of R:61, G:203, B:82 and CMYK values of C:0.7, M:0, Y:0.6,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 4049746.

Hex triplet 3dcb52 #3dcb52
RGB Decimal 61, 203, 82 rgb(61,203,82)
RGB Percent 23.9, 79.6, 32.2 rgb(23.9%,79.6%,32.2%)
CMYK 70, 0, 60, 20
HSL 128.9°, 57.7, 51.8 hsl(128.9,57.7%,51.8%)
HSV (or HSB) 128.9°, 70, 79.6
Web Safe 33cc66 #33cc66
CIE-LAB 72.436, -61.678, 48.661
XYZ 24.802, 44.311, 15.228
xyY 0.294, 0.525, 44.311
CIE-LCH 72.436, 78.562, 141.728
CIE-LUV 72.436, -59.222, 69.811
Hunter-Lab 66.566, -49.984, 33.033
Binary 00111101, 11001011, 01010010

Shades and Tints of #3dcb52

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020703 is the darkest color, while #f7fdf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#3dcb52

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7f8981 is the less saturated color, while #0efa31 is the most saturated one.
